Classroom Management Strategies for Success
Effective teaching copyrights on strong space control. Implementing successful techniques can significantly boost student participation and minimize disruptions. Here are a few important read more strategies to evaluate:
- Define clear rules from the start.
- Utilize positive reinforcement to recognize good conduct.
- Employ silent signals to correct distracted learners.
- Structure the physical space to facilitate study.
- Build strong bonds with your learners to encourage trust.
By repeatedly applying these strategies, teachers can create a positive and pleasant educational setting for all involved.
Dynamic Activities for the Classroom
To boost student engagement , it's crucial to move beyond traditional lectures. Consider incorporating a selection of active learning techniques . These could include quick brainstorming sessions , where students express their opinions on a subject . Group projects, where pupils work together to tackle a problem , are an additional powerful option . Gamification , with points and tests , can encourage even the somewhat reluctant learners. Alternatively, acting scenarios allow students to experience different perspectives firsthand. Finally, pictorial aids like clips and illustrations can make complex notions more accessible .
- Idea Generation
- Group Projects
- Gamification
- Acting
- Visual Aids
